According to tradition, the birds and the bees is a metaphorical story sometimes told to children in an attempt to explain the mechanics and good consequences of sexual intercourse through reference to easily observed natural events. The birds and the bees talk sometimes known simply as the talk is generally the event in most childrens lives in which the parents explain what sexual relationships are.
